Real estate transactions can be complex and overwhelming, requiring a thorough understanding of the legal processes involved. This is where real estate solicitors come in. A real estate solicitor is a lawyer specialized in property law who handles all legal aspects of buying, selling, and leasing real estate properties. Their expertise is essential in ensuring that property transactions are carried out smoothly and in compliance with the law. One of the primary responsibilities of real estate solicitors is to conduct due diligence on the property being transacted. This involves verifying the legal status of the property, checking for any encumbrances or restrictions, and ensuring that the property is free from any legal disputes or claims. By conducting thorough due diligence, real estate solicitors can identify any potential legal issues that may arise during the transaction and advise their clients accordingly. This not only helps prevent costly legal disputes in the future but also ensures that the transaction proceeds smoothly and in compliance with the law.
In addition to due diligence, real estate solicitors also play a key role in drafting and reviewing legal documents related to the property transaction. This includes contracts of sale, lease agreements, mortgage documents, and other legal instruments that are essential for completing the transaction. real estate solicitors are well-versed in property law and have the expertise to draft legally binding contracts that protect their clients’ interests and reflect the terms agreed upon by the parties involved. By having a real estate solicitor draft and review legal documents, clients can rest assured that their rights are protected and that the transaction is legally sound.
real estate solicitors also handle negotiations between the parties involved in the transaction, such as buyers, sellers, landlords, and tenants. They help their clients navigate complex legal issues and ensure that their interests are represented in negotiations. Real estate transactions can be fraught with disagreements and misunderstandings, and having a skilled negotiator on your side can make all the difference in achieving a successful outcome. Real estate solicitors use their knowledge of property law and negotiation skills to reach favorable agreements for their clients and ensure that their interests are protected throughout the transaction.
Another important aspect of real estate solicitors’ work is liaising with other professionals involved in the transaction, such as real estate agents, surveyors, and mortgage brokers. Real estate transactions require coordination between various parties, and real estate solicitors play a crucial role in facilitating communication and ensuring that all aspects of the transaction are handled efficiently. By working closely with other professionals, real estate solicitors can streamline the transaction process and ensure that all legal requirements are met in a timely manner.
